Liberal pundit Marc Lamont Hill deletes 'joke' about Tom Hanks, coronavirus: 'Wasn’t trying to be mean'


Author and liberal pundit Marc Lamont Hill was condemned after he responded to the news about Tom Hanks and his wife testing positive for coronavirus with a “joke” that was labeled racist by critics. Call me when Will and Jada got it,” Hill captioned a tweet announcing Hanks and wife Rita Wilson have coronavirus. CNN dropped Lamont Hill in 2018 after he gave a speech at the United Nations in which he used language critics described as a dog whistle, advocating for the elimination of Israel. Critics noted that numerous anti-Israel groups use the phrase “from the river to the sea” regularly, including the terror group Hamas.
